On the abortion issue. There isn't actual fetal tissue in the vaccines. Cells have been grown from the fetus of an abortion from 1973. So the cells are not from the original fetus but have been grown from it in a labratory through many generations. In the Moderna and Pfizer the cells were used in the research & development phase. The J&J they were also used in production and manufacturing phase.
